UPON hearing counsel the Court made the following O R D E R In SLP(C) No.11831/11 respondent no.4 seeks time for filing vakalatnama and counter affidavit. Ld.counsel for the petitioner submits that pursuant to the direction of this Court, the petitioner had remitted the process fee and spare copy prior to 9.01.2012 which could not be brought to the notice of the Court on 9.01.2012. On the above basis, Ld.counsel submits that the order imposing cost was not justified. Office is directed to verify whether the petitioner had remitted the process fee and spare copy as submitted. In SLP(C) No.24224/10 Ld.counsel for the
petitioner has filed an affidavit stating that when he went to serve dasti notice issued by the Supreme Court through the Court of Senior Sub Judge, Ludhiana he was informed by the Nazir that the photostat copies of the summons cannot be accepted and required him to furnish the summons in original with the seal and signature. The photocopies of the summons issued from the Court has been filed along with. Office to verify whether original summons have been issued to the petitioner and if not how it happened.

In SLP(C) No. 11510/11 Ld.counsel for the petitioner has not remitted the process fee and spare copy in spite of last chance granted. However, I am inclined to grant three more weeks time subject to the condition that he files the process fee/spare copy and deposits a sum of Rs. 500/- in the Supreme Court Legal Services Committee as cost within three weeks. If the above conditions are not satisfied, list the matter before the Hon'ble Judge in Chambers for nonprosecution. If steps are taken, issue notice. Await return of notice. In SLP(C) No.1059/11 Ld.counsel for the petitioner has not taken steps to bring on record the Lrs. of deceased respondents. Petitioner is granted four weeks time for taking necessary steps. The petitioner has also not remitted the process fee and spare copy for issuing notice to respondent Nos. 1 & 13. Petitioner is granted three more weeks time as a last chance for remitting the process fee and spare copy. In SLP(C) No.26806/10 it is reported that respondent No.6 is dead. Petitioner is directed to verify and take steps if any required. In SLP(C) No.25614/10 notice addressed to respondent Nos. 4,10 and 18 have been returned unserved. Ld.counsel for the petitioner is granted four weeks time for taking fresh steps against the unserved respondents.
In SLP(C) No.26787/10 it is reported that respondent No.14 has expired. Petitioner to take steps if any within four weeks.

In all other remaining cases, the served respondents are granted four weeks time for filing counter affidavit. Await return of notice of the unserved respondents. List the matter on 30.03.2012.
